there is no such thing as the speed of gravity.
Gravity is an acceleration, a= 32 ft/sec/sec
Top floor is 1355 ft high
The equation is 1355 = 1/2 a t^2
solving for t, you get 9.2 seconds for time it would take top floor to reach street level if it was a free fall.
